Topic: Fishing Reports|
The Bow is coming in to shape. Visibility today was reasonable despite yesterday morning’s rain - 18″ along the banks. Recommended fishing methods include streamer fishing hard to the bank and nymphing. Flies of choice include Conehead Rubber Bugger, San Juan Worm, stonefly nymphs, and small nymph patterns such as the evil weevil, prince nymph, and copper johns. Some reports of hatches including larger PMD’s and Yellow Sally stoneflies.
Reports of good fishing all the way to MacKinnon’s Flats including below the Highwood.

Topic: Team Fish Tales|
Terry’s spent most of his life as an angler and easily the last 20 years as a fly angler. He loves the sport of fly fishing, but beyond that enjoys sharing his knowledge and experience with others including his four sons.
Terry is head guide for Fish Tales and as such has developed a reputation as one of the hardest working guides on the Bow. He’s often seen hauling the boat back upstream so his client’s can have a second (or even third) chance to fish a run….
When Terry isn’t guiding or in the shop he’s spending time on nearby trout waters or heading out on other fishing adventures. Recently, Terry’s fishing adventures have included trips to Cuba where he fishes for bonefish, ‘cuda, and tarpon. Prior to catching the saltwater bug, Terry made regular trips west where he enjoyed fishing for B.C. steelhead.

Topic: Fishing Reports|
The Bow is running high and dirty because of the recent rains. If you decide to go out, fish the banks and quieter water with streamers and large nymphs such as San Juan Worms, stoneflies, and leeches.
Exercise caution while wading because banks can be unstable and gravel bars will have shifted.
